William M. Burns |
CWGC:
Rank: Private
Regiment: Highland Hight Infantry, 9th (Glasgow Highlanders) Battalion
No: 2427
Date of Death: 14th October 1915
Age: 20
Commemorated: Loos Memorial
Additional Information: Son of William MacKnight Burns and Marion Symington Burns, 138 Garthland Drive, Glasgow
